on MouseOver kommt Anfängerhilfe

F

force2k1

download counter !!!

Ich möchte einen Download Counter machen !

Wo ein Download dann zb über folgendes aufgerufen werden soll:
redirect.php?id=14

der downloads auch die von id=1 usw sollen alle in einer download.txt gespeichert werden !

und neben den dl auf der page möchte in dann die download klicks stehen haben !!!


Wie mache ich das ???


THX force2k1
 
Logisch gesehen ganz einfach.

Du machst ne Page name z.B. download.asp oder als php'ler download.php

uebergibst per querystring die id des downloads.
Speicherst dann Daten in die DB wie du willst :
Download count z.B.
oder auch moeglich die Zeit wann der Download stattgefunden hatte
oder was auch ganz witzig ist wenn du sowas wie ein memberbereich mit Login hast kannst du auch die in der session gespeicherten Namen automatisch uebertragen :)
dann weisst du immer wer auf welche Pornos steht und sie saugt :)

nach erfassen der links gehts per meta-refresh direkt zum zip file ;)
das wars

naja der Phantasie sind auch hier keine grenzengesetzt.
 
...

danke aber das funzt irgend wie nicht !!!

ich meinte das das so sein sollte:

man legt in der redirect.php die id´s fest

id=1: http://www.domain.de/file.zip
id=2: http://www.domain.de/file2.zip

usw und wenn man dann redirect.php?id=1 aufruft soll der dann den klick zählen den der in einer txt abspeichert und dann halt zum download gehen ! aber wenn es geht nicht über eine metaweiterleitung !

und dann brauch ich noch nen script der dann aus der txt ausliest wieviele klicks gemacht wurden !

am besten wäre es wenn die txt so aussehen würde:

1
3
4
7
8
9
0


wie mach ich sowas ?
 
naja du übergibts an die redirect.php deine daten und speicherst die in ner txt oder in ner db!

und dann machste noch nen meta tag z.b.:
Code:
<meta http-equiv="refresh" content="1; URL=http://www.domain.de">

content gibt hier die zeit in sekunden an!

ich hoffe ich konnte dir helfen! oder meinste noch was anderes??
 
in PHP lässt sich ein Redirekt so erledigen:

header("Location: http://www.seite.de");

das Ganze dann noch in einer Switch-Abfrage, und das war's ;)

Gruß
Dunsti
 
das geht so

Das ist doch easy !

PHP:
<?
if ($id=="1")
{header("location: datei.exe");}
elseif ($id=="2")
{header("location: datei2.exe");}
?>


P.S.: Den DL Counter hab ich schon lange fertig :)
 

Neue Beiträge

Zurück